di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Contents.json b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Contents.json index 1d060ed..5a0d8cd 100644 --- a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Contents.json +++ b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Contents.json @@ -11,33 +11,39 @@ "scale" : "3x" }, { - "idiom" : "iphone", "size" : "29x29", + "idiom" : "iphone", + "filename" : "Icon-Small@2x.png", "scale" : "2x" }, { - "idiom" : "iphone", "size" : "29x29", + "idiom" : "iphone", + "filename" : "Icon-Small@3x.png", "scale" : "3x" }, { - "idiom" : "iphone", "size" : "40x40", + "idiom" : "iphone", + "filename" : "Icon-Spotlight-40@2x-1.png", "scale" : "2x" }, { - "idiom" : "iphone", "size" : "40x40", + "idiom" : "iphone", + "filename" : "Icon-Spotlight-40@3x.png", "scale" : "3x" }, { - "idiom" : "iphone", "size" : "60x60", + "idiom" : "iphone", + "filename" : "Icon-60@2x.png", "scale" : "2x" }, { - "idiom" : "iphone", "size" : "60x60", + "idiom" : "iphone", + "filename" : "Icon-60@3x.png", "scale" : "3x" }, { @@ -51,38 +57,45 @@ "scale" : "2x" }, { - "idiom" : "ipad", "size" : "29x29", + "idiom" : "ipad", + "filename" : "Icon-Small.png", "scale" : "1x" }, { - "idiom" : "ipad", "size" : "29x29", + "idiom" : "ipad", + "filename" : "Icon-Small@2x-1.png", "scale" : "2x" }, { - "idiom" : "ipad", "size" : "40x40", + "idiom" : "ipad", + "filename" : "Icon-Spotlight-40.png", "scale" : "1x" }, { - "idiom" : "ipad", "size" : "40x40", + "idiom" : "ipad", + "filename" : "Icon-Spotlight-40@2x.png", "scale" : "2x" }, { - "idiom" : "ipad", "size" : "76x76", + "idiom" : "ipad", + "filename" : "Icon-76.png", "scale" : "1x" }, { - "idiom" : "ipad", "size" : "76x76", + "idiom" : "ipad", + "filename" : "Icon-76@2x.png", "scale" : "2x" }, { - "idiom" : "ipad", "size" : "83.5x83.5", + "idiom" : "ipad", + "filename" : "Icon-iPadPro@2x.png", "scale" : "2x" } ], di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-60@2x.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-60@2x.png new file mode 100644 index 0000000..1591ba4 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-60@2x.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-60@3x.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-60@3x.png new file mode 100644 index 0000000..d932686 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-60@3x.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-76.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-76.png new file mode 100644 index 0000000..e2d66ab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-76.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-76@2x.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-76@2x.png new file mode 100644 index 0000000..a9e05cf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-76@2x.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small.png new file mode 100644 index 0000000..a871b7a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@2x-1.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@2x-1.png new file mode 100644 index 0000000..c6ba766 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@2x-1.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@2x.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@2x.png new file mode 100644 index 0000000..c6ba766 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@2x.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@3x.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@3x.png new file mode 100644 index 0000000..69a51ad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Small@3x.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40.png new file mode 100644 index 0000000..7a7891d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@2x-1.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@2x-1.png new file mode 100644 index 0000000..a7ff64e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@2x-1.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@2x.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@2x.png new file mode 100644 index 0000000..a7ff64e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@2x.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@3x.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@3x.png new file mode 100644 index 0000000..5578715 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-Spotlight-40@3x.png differ diff --git a/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-iPadPro@2x.png b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-iPadPro@2x.png new file mode 100644 index 0000000..81662be Binary files /dev/null and b/GLTableCollectionView/Assets.xcassets/AppIcon.appiconset/Icon-iPadPro@2x.png differ diff --git a/GLTableCollectionView/Base.lproj/LaunchScreen.storyboard b/GLTableCollectionView/Base.lproj/LaunchScreen.storyboard index fdf3f97..6e3a1ad 100644 --- a/GLTableCollectionView/Base.lproj/LaunchScreen.storyboard +++ b/GLTableCollectionView/Base.lproj/LaunchScreen.storyboard @@ -1,7 +1,11 @@ - + + + + - + + @@ -18,10 +22,27 @@ + - + + + + + + + + + + + + + + + + + diff --git a/GLTableCollectionView/Base.lproj/Main.storyboard b/GLTableCollectionView/Base.lproj/Main.storyboard index 912e30f..1fbb3c5 100644 --- a/GLTableCollectionView/Base.lproj/Main.storyboard +++ b/GLTableCollectionView/Base.lproj/Main.storyboard @@ -1,8 +1,11 @@ - + + + + - + diff --git a/GLTableCollectionView/GLIndexedCollectionViewCell.xib b/GLTableCollectionView/GLIndexedCollectionViewCell.xib index 27deeb2..59acf4a 100644 --- a/GLTableCollectionView/GLIndexedCollectionViewCell.xib +++ b/GLTableCollectionView/GLIndexedCollectionViewCell.xib @@ -1,8 +1,11 @@ - + + + + - + diff --git a/GLTableCollectionViewTests/GLTableCollectionViewTests.swift b/GLTableCollectionViewTests/GLTableCollectionViewTests.swift index 0b9221d..5c91321 100644 --- a/GLTableCollectionViewTests/GLTableCollectionViewTests.swift +++ b/GLTableCollectionViewTests/GLTableCollectionViewTests.swift @@ -10,27 +10,15 @@ import XCTest @testable import GLTableCollectionView class GLTableCollectionViewTests: XCTestCase { - - override func setUp() { + override func setUp() { super.setUp() - // Put setup code here. This method is called before the invocation of each test method in the class. + // Put setup code here. This method is called before the invocation of + // each test method in the class. } override func tearDown() { - // Put teardown code here. This method is called after the invocation of each test method in the class. + // Put teardown code here. This method is called after the invocation of + // each test method in the class. super.tearDown() } - - func testExample() { - // This is an example of a functional test case. - // Use XCTAssert and related functions to verify your tests produce the correct results. - } - - func testPerformanceExample() { - // This is an example of a performance test case. - self.measure { - // Put the code you want to measure the time of here. - } - } - } diff --git a/GitHub Page/Images/Source/Icon.pxm b/GitHub Page/Images/Source/Icon.pxm new file mode 100644 index 0000000..0b10e7d Binary files /dev/null and b/GitHub Page/Images/Source/Icon.pxm differ